Forum |  HardWare.fr | News | Articles | PC | S'identifier | S'inscrire | Shop Recherche
2535 connectés 

  FORUM HardWare.fr
  Programmation
  SQL/NoSQL

  [MySQL] Impossible de se logguer root sur un autre poste que localhost

 


 Mot :   Pseudo :  
 
Bas de page
Auteur Sujet :

[MySQL] Impossible de se logguer root sur un autre poste que localhost

n°1269769
totof74
Posté le 19-12-2005 à 10:54:55  profilanswer
 

:hello: à tous,
 
Voilà, j'ai réussi à tout mettre dans le titre !
Donc j'ai une base de donnée mysql sur un pc en réseau local.
Si j'essaie de me connecter root en local sur le pc hébergeant la base : pas de problème
Si j'essaie de me connecter root depuis un autre pc, j'ai le message :
 
"
Erreur d'exécution SQL (1045). Response de la Base de Données :
[Access denied for user 'root'@'NomDuPcDepuisLequelJeMeConnecte' (using password: YES)
Vérifiez le nom et le mot de passe de l'utilisateur.
Ensuite demandez à l'administrateur de la base de données (fournisseur d'accès) si vous êtes autorisé à vous connecter sur cet hôte.]
"
 
Evidement le user/password est correct puisque je me connecte sans problème en local.
Avec un autre compte que root, on arrive bien à se connecter à distance.
 
Pour être tout à fait exhaustif, j'ai eu un problème : j'avais perdu le pwd root, j'ai du le réinitialiser après avoir fait un --skip-grant-tables au démarrage du serveur.
 
Configuration :
Windows 2000 SP4
MySQL 4.1.14-nt via TCP/IP
 
Merci à tous ceux qui voudront bien essayer de me donner un coup de main.

mood
Publicité
Posté le 19-12-2005 à 10:54:55  profilanswer
 

n°1269783
totof74
Posté le 19-12-2005 à 11:10:21  profilanswer
 

Bon ben je crois que j'ai trouvé....
C'est fait pour des raisons de sécurité, root n'est autorisé à se connecter que depuis localhost ! C'est modifiable, il faut changer les droits root :
GRANT ALL PRIVILEGES ON *.* TO 'root'@'localhost' IDENTIFIED BY PASSWORD 'xxxxxxxxxxxxxxxxxxxxxxx' WITH GRANT OPTION;
 
en remplacant 'localhost' par '%'.
 
J'ai pas essayé, en fait je crois que je vais laisser comme ça et créer un autre compte avec un peu plus de privilège pour faire ce qu'il faut.

n°1269932
leflos5
On est ou on est pas :)
Posté le 19-12-2005 à 14:30:53  profilanswer
 

C'est bien ça ;)


Aller à :
Ajouter une réponse
  FORUM HardWare.fr
  Programmation
  SQL/NoSQL

  [MySQL] Impossible de se logguer root sur un autre poste que localhost

 

Sujets relatifs
Triple jointure MySQLupdate sous mysql
[mysql] recherche "distinct"Site PHP/Mysql
Mysql sous linux[ MySQL] chaines de caractères : LEFT() / RIGHT()
[MySQL] Recherche de mots dans un blobconnexion et echange de donnée avec base mysql
DELPHI DBExpress et MySqlimpossible de lire l'animation
Plus de sujets relatifs à : [MySQL] Impossible de se logguer root sur un autre poste que localhost


Copyright © 1997-2022 Hardware.fr SARL (Signaler un contenu illicite / Données personnelles) / Groupe LDLC / Shop HFR